#370748 basic color information

#370748

In the RGB color model, hex triplet #370748 has decimal index of: 3606344, is composed of 21.6% red, 2.7% green and 28.2% blue. #370748 in CMYK color model, is composed of 23.6% cyan, 90.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 71.8% black.
#330033 is the closest web-safe color to #370748.

Analogous colors

They are colors that are next to each other on the color wheel. Analogous colors tend to look pleasant together, because they are closely related.
